In this exercise, we aim to help young ballet students improve their understanding and execution of pas de bourée dessous. The main focus is on achieving precise footwork.
Preparation: Students to have a 3m (10ft) long resistance band and wrap it twice in an outward direction around the top of each thigh.
Steps:
1. Position the students facing the ballet barre with their right foot placed forward in 3rd position.
2. On the end of the musical introduction, instruct them to lift their back foot and bring it into cou de pied derrière (coupé position) en fondu (plié).
3. Guide them through performing a pas de bourée dessous.
4. Repeat by bringing their foot into cou de pied derrière again.
5. Encourage repetitions to assist the muscle memory.
Focus: Throughout this exercise, pay close attention that the students are maintaining correct foot alignment and ensuring smooth transitions between each step.
